Year: 1973 Language: English Author: Summerskill Michael Genre: Study Guide Publisher: STEVENS & SONS LIMITED ISBN: 42043720 Format: PDF Quality: Scanned pages Number of pages: 300 Description: Summerskill is a comprehensive treatment of the law of laytime under English law. It presents the general principles of laytime and demurrage offering orientation to newcomers as well as providing an overview to experienced practitioners. Examines all the key aspects of laytime:- The charterer’s duties and considerations, the nature of the laytime, its calculation, legal/ contractual “excuses” for delay, demurrage, damages for detention Goes through the practical and legal considerations which determine whether a party has complied with the laytime terms of a voyage charterparty or a sale of goods contract Explains the consequences of failure to comply Shows how damages are assessed Provides detailed commentary on the laytime and demurrage clauses from a range of charterparties Examines English arbitration awards in detail Introduces chapters on damages for detention and on sales contracts Features a glossary of specialist terms Provides working examples for various calculations, such as demurrage and dispatch
